Which of the following ordered pairs represents the solution to the system given below?

2x + y = 20
4x − 2y = 40

Multiply the 1st row by 2

4x+2y=40

4x-2y=40

Subtract the 2nd row from the 1st row

4y=0
Solve for y in the above equation

4x+2×0=40
Solve for x in the above equation

x = 10

y = 0
